We are seeking a highly skilled Infrastructure Analyst who will be responsible for deploying product updates, identifying production issues and implementing cloud integrations.
Key Skills:
- Good understanding of TCP/IP, Azure virtual networking, including VNETs, VWAN, Express Route and Virtual Network Gateways, Hub & Spoke Network Topology, VPN Failover
- Good understanding of Application Gateways, Load Balancer, Azure Firewall and Front Door
- Good understanding of Azure Security Principles, including Managed Identities, Key Vault, Conditional Access and Azure Security Centre
- Good knowledge of Azure Compute, Storage, Webapps, Azure Migrate (ASR), Azure Site Recovery and Azure Backup
Objectives:
- Building and setting up new development tools and infrastructure
- Understanding the needs of stakeholders and architect carrying this from requirement to design
- Working on ways to automate and improve development and release processes
- Testing and examining code written by others and analysing results
- Ensuring that systems are safe and secure against cybersecurity threats
- Identifying technical architects, application developers and Cloud SMEs to ensure that development follows established processes and works as intended
- Planning out projects and being involved in project management decisions
